Unpacking
The motherboard is shipped in antistatic packaging to avoid static damage.
When unpacking the board, make sure the person handling it is static pro-
tected.

Motherboard Installation

This section explains the first step of physically mounting the P3TDDE into
the SC822 chassis. Following the steps in the order given will eliminate the
most common problems encountered in such an installation. To remove the
motherboard, follow the procedure in reverse order.
1.
Accessing the inside of the 6021i (see Figure 2-5):
Two release buttons are located on the top cover of the chassis.
Depressing both of these buttons while pushing the cover away from
you until it stops. You can then lift the top cover from the chassis
to gain full access to the inside of the server. (If already installed in
a rack, you must first release the retention screws that secure the
unit to the rack. Then grasp the two handles on either side and pull
the unit straight out until the rails lock into place.)
2.
Check compatibility of motherboard ports and I/O shield:
The P3TDDE requires a chassis big enough to support an 11.6" x
11.2" (294.64 mm x 284.48 mm) full ATX motherboard, such as
Supermicro's SC822 2U rackmount. Make certain that the I/O ports
on the motherboard properly align with their respective holes in the I/
O shield at the back of the chassis.
3.
Mounting the motherboard onto the motherboard tray:
Carefully mount the motherboard to the motherboard tray by aligning
the board holes with the raised metal standoffs that are visible on
the bottom of the chassis. Insert screws into all the mounting holes
on your motherboard that line up with the standoffs and tighten until
snug (if you screw them in too tight, you might strip the threads).
Metal screws provide an electrical contact to the motherboard ground
to provide a continuous ground for the system.
